Ok, I can confirm there are lots of issues here.

[B]When fetching work..[/B]
1. The login completes OK
2. The request for work has three failure points
a. My logged in session appears to be gone and I think my results are being assigned to anonymous
b. There is an error on the page
[QUOTE]
Undefined variable: t_user in [B]C:\v5\www\manual_assignment\default.php[/B] on line [B]98[/B]
[/QUOTE]
3. The results page changed in such a way that MISFIT no longer finds the right section of the HTML to parse out the factors.

So the MISFIT request for work is allocating factors, but they are lost due to page errors/changes.


[B]When submitting work:[/B]
1. The login page is failing to log the user in
2. It is sporadic
3. when it does login, MISFIT uploads are fine.

Chuck has already confirmed sporadic upload completion.

MISFIT will require work. I've unwound changes to manual assignment and results pages pending a new version of MISFIT.

1) You cannot use the old login page/mechanism to login to the new pages.
Go to [url]http://mersenne.org/manual_assignment/default_new.php[/url]. Login on that page (it will keep you on that page). Then get your assignments.

2) Same login issue with the results page. If you are parsing the results from that page, go to [url]http://mersenne.org/manual_results/default_new.php[/url] to see what the page outputs.

I'll fix the t_user error on line 98 that you reported (attempt to get an assignment when not logged in).
